Evaluation of using laser fluorescence technique with Methylen Blue Dye in Detection of Enamel and Dentin Cracks of Dental Crown
Abstract
Dental cracks in mineralized structures (Enamel and Dentin) are one of complicated aspects in operative dentistry. Considering Limitations in diagnosis of such cracks in clinical situations reveals the need of further studies to find new techniques and technologies in this regard. In present study laser fluorescence technique via using Diagnodent device was studied as a new method of detecting dental and enamel cracks painted with methylene blue dye. Methods and materials: In 20 extracted sound third molar teeth , several dentinal and enamel cracks were provided using Instron Device and special isolated cracks of the teeth selected and their width were measured by stereomicroscope device. After painting of these cracks using methylene blue dye, Diagnodent value of each selected and painted crack was measured and then these values and the values of sound enamel and dentin surfaces were analyzed statistically. Results: Mean value of enamel cracks was 18.42 while this number was 1.5 in sound enamel surface. Mean value of dentin cracks was 28.5 and the mean value for sound dentin was 28.5. (p<0.01). There was a significant correlation between cracks width and Diagnodent values of painted cracks both in enamel and dentin. Conclusion: According to the findings of this study Diagnodent would be used a clinical device for detection of enamel and dentinal cracks of sound teeth crowns.
